How to Reduce Salon No-Shows With WhatsApp Reminders

No-shows quietly drain revenue and wreck your schedule. Here is a practical, WhatsApp-first system to cut them — built for Malaysian salons, spas and clinics.

A single no-show is more than one empty chair. It is revenue you can never get back, a stylist paid to stand idle, and a slot a paying customer could not book. Across a month, a handful of no-shows a week quietly becomes one of the biggest leaks in a salon’s cash flow. The good news: it is also one of the easiest leaks to fix, and the fix lives inside an app your customers already use every day — WhatsApp.

Key takeaways

  • A no-show is revenue you can never recover — an empty slot cannot be resold after the fact.
  • Automated WhatsApp confirmations + reminders are the single most effective fix, cutting no-shows by up to 40%.
  • Small deposits (RM 10–30) filter out non-serious bookings without scaring off good customers.
  • A clear, kind cancellation policy, stated up front, resets expectations.
  • Track your no-show rate monthly — what gets measured gets managed.

What no-shows really cost your salon

Do the maths on your own numbers. Say you average five no-shows a week at an average ticket of RM 80. That is RM 400 a week, roughly RM 1,600 a month — over RM 19,000 a year — walking out the door before you count wasted product, idle staff wages and the customers you turned away for those slots.

Once you see no-shows as a monthly number rather than an occasional annoyance, fixing them becomes an obvious priority.

The WhatsApp reminder system that works

You do not need to nag. You need the right message at the right moment, sent automatically:

  1. 1Instant confirmation the moment a booking is made — date, time, service and location.
  2. 2A reminder 24 hours before, with a one-tap link to reschedule if needed.
  3. 3A final nudge 2–3 hours before — this is the one that saves same-day slots.
  4. 4A friendly follow-up if they miss, inviting them to rebook (and keeping the relationship warm).

Should you take deposits?

For high-value services and first-time customers, a small deposit dramatically cuts no-shows because there is now something at stake. The key is to keep it small (RM 10–30), explain it kindly, and apply it straight to the final bill so it never feels like a penalty.

💡 Do not demand deposits from loyal, reliable regulars — reserve them for new bookings and expensive treatments where the risk is real.

Write a cancellation policy customers respect

A good policy is short, fair and stated before booking — not sprung on someone after they miss. Aim for something like: “Please give us 4 hours’ notice to cancel or reschedule so we can offer the slot to someone else.”

How much do no-shows cost a typical Malaysian salon?+

It varies, but five no-shows a week at an average RM 80 ticket is roughly RM 1,600 a month — before wasted product and idle staff time. Tracking your own no-show rate turns a vague annoyance into a number you can act on.

Do WhatsApp reminders really reduce no-shows?+

Yes. Because customers actually read WhatsApp (unlike SMS or email), automated confirmations and reminders with an easy reschedule option commonly cut no-shows by 30–40%.

Will asking for a deposit drive customers away?+

A small, clearly explained deposit that applies to the final bill rarely deters genuine customers — it mainly filters out the non-serious. Reserve deposits for new bookings and high-value services.

How far in advance should reminders go out?+

A two-touch approach works best: one reminder 24 hours before, and a final nudge 2–3 hours before. The same-day reminder is the one that rescues most slots.
